Alvin Garcia was the first-ever winner of the Charles Walters Trophy, given annually to the provincial foil champion. Garcia won the title in both 1937-38 and 1938-39, while claiming the individual fencing champion title in 1936-37 and 1937-38. He helped the Blues to senior team titles in 1936-37 and 1938-39, while receiving his Bronze T in 1939.
Alvin also participated in intramural hockey and fencing, and served on the club executive for boxing, wrestling and fencing.
